午夜剧场伦理_日本一道高清_国产又黄又硬_91黄色网战_女同久久另类69精品国产_妹妹的朋友在线

您的位置:首頁技術文章
文章詳情頁

mysql - 這句sql 為什么不能查詢出所有的 qdwyc_zlgs的信息,總是查出兩條?不是應該三條嗎?

瀏覽:221日期:2022-06-17 08:41:38

問題描述

SELECT a.*, COUNT(a.id) AS numFROM qdwyc_zlgs aLEFT JOIN qdwyc_car b ON a.id = b.car_zlgsLEFT JOIN qdwyc_hy_sj c ON b.car_owner = c.idWHERE b. STATUS = 0AND c. STATUS = 0AND c.sj_is_sh = 1group BY a.id

mysql - 這句sql 為什么不能查詢出所有的 qdwyc_zlgs的信息,總是查出兩條?不是應該三條嗎?

mysql - 這句sql 為什么不能查詢出所有的 qdwyc_zlgs的信息,總是查出兩條?不是應該三條嗎?

問題解答

回答1:

1+2=3 啊。你不是 group by a.id 了嘛,所以相同的就合并成一條了。

MySQL 允許選擇不在 group by 語句中、也沒有使用聚集函數的字段,但是結果是哪條數據的值就不知道了。PostgreSQL 遇到這樣的情景是會報錯的。

回答2:

你的查詢條件

WHERE b.STATUS = 0 AND c. STATUS = 0 AND c.sj_is_sh = 1

過濾了

回答3:

你先把group by a.id先去掉看看查詢數據結果怎么樣的。先從簡單的sql語句,一步一步的調試

主站蜘蛛池模板: 日韩中文字幕久久 | 九九操 | 亚洲开心网| 欧美不卡视频在线观看 | 亚欧视频在线观看 | 亚洲精品日韩丝袜精品 | 久久久www | 91爱爱网站| 欧美亚日韩 | 亚洲日本中文字幕在线 | 欧美激情精品久久久久 | 国产片91| 三级视频小说 | 三级视频久久 | 国产免费一区二区三区 | 成人毛片在线观看 | 国产精品美女网站 | 一区二区三区在线观看免费视频 | 国产欧美视频在线 | 国产不卡在线观看视频 | 色一情一伦一子一伦一区 | 中文字幕1 | 免费观看毛片 | 四虎视频国产精品免费入口 | 九一精品视频 | 日韩欧美在线中文字幕 | 91免费精品| 亚洲一区二区三区在线观看视频 | 欧美成人精品在线观看 | 动漫av网 | 久久xxxx| 91精品国产乱码久久久久 | 成人三级av| 久久黄色免费网站 | 日韩av自拍 | 久久久久久国产精品 | 精品天堂 | 午夜天堂 | 久久综合一区二区 | 欧美日本韩国一区二区三区 | 男人天堂网在线视频 |